
In eighteenth century France, the evil Prince de Montrale falls in love with Liane, but she runs away from him and seeks refuge in a monastery. The prince finds her and orders the abbot to keep her in custody. A young novice, Brother Paul, is placed in charge of Liane and falls in love with her, despite having just taken his vows of celibacy.
